During the 4-day exhibition, Swisspacer invited customers to join them for an evening of dinner and entertainment at Dr. Thompson’s Seifenfabrik in Dusseldorf – an old soap factory with many of its original and unique features making it a spectacular venue for hosting and dining. The occasion was in celebration of Swisspacer’s 20th anniversary of warm edge manufacturing and included live music throughout the evening.
Jan Hiersemenzel, Marketing Director for Europe at Swisspacer, adds: “glasstec is a great platform for networking and meeting customers. It gives the opportunity to update target audiences on the latest news and innovations as well as remind the market about the different ways Swisspacer can be processed. With developments in CALUWIN and AIR too, it was a busy stand at one of the most important shows in the glazing calendar!”
